2007 Festival Review
The Arts Council of Clinton proudly presented these juried fine artists at the 24th Annual Brick Streets FINE ARTS Festival on May 5, 2007 from 9:00 a.m. to 4:00 p.m. on the brick streets of historic Olde Towne Clinton.
